Zanzibar and the other Indian Ocean Island of Pemba to the north have between them some of the best diving in East Africa.
Dive sites here are suitable for every level of experience and all can enjoy spectacular levels of visibility, from 20-60 meters in waters that average a very comfortable 27 degrees.
